- Windows PowerShell
- Copyright (C) Microsoft Corporation. All rights reserved.
- PS E:\Test-ESP32\ESP32_Bluetooth\fast_prov_server> C:\ESP32\.espressif\python_env\idf4.3_py3.8_env\Scripts\python.exe C:\ESP32\esp-idf\tools\idf.py -p COM2 monitor
- Executing action: monitor
- Running idf_monitor in directory e:\test-esp32\esp32_bluetooth\fast_prov_server
- Executing "C:\ESP32\.espressif\python_env\idf4.3_py3.8_env\Scripts\python.exe C:/ESP32/esp-idf/tools/idf_monitor.py -p COM2 -b 115200 --toolchain-prefix xtensa-esp32-elf- e:\test-esp32\esp32_bluetooth\fast_prov_server\build\fast_prov_server.elf -m 'C:\ESP32\.espressif\python_env\idf4.3_py3.8_env\Scripts\python.exe' 'C:\ESP32\esp-idf\tools\idf.py' '-p' 'COM2'"...
- ?[0;33m--- WARNING: GDB cannot open serial ports accessed as COMx?[0m
- ?[0;33m--- Using \\.\COM2 instead...?[0m
- --- idf_monitor on \\.\COM2 115200 ---
- --- Quit: Ctrl+] | Menu: Ctrl+T | Help: Ctrl+T followed by Ctrl+H ---
- ets Jun 8 2016 00:22:57
- rst:0x1 (POWERON_RESET),boot:0x13 (SPI_FAST_FLASH_BOOT)
- configsip: 0, SPIWP:0xee
- clk_drv:0x00,q_drv:0x00,d_drv:0x00,cs0_drv:0x00,hd_drv:0x00,wp_drv:0x00
- mode:DIO, clock div:2
- load:0x3fff0030,len:6912
- load:0x40078000,len:14292
- ho 0 tail 12 room 4
- load:0x40080400,len:3688
- 0x40080400: _init at ??:?
- entry 0x40080678
- I (28) boot: ESP-IDF v4.3 2nd stage bootloader
- I (28) boot: compile time 17:38:22
- I (28) boot: chip revision: 1
- I (31) boot_comm: chip revision: 1, min. bootloader chip revision: 0
- I (38) boot.esp32: SPI Speed : 40MHz
- I (42) boot.esp32: SPI Mode : DIO
- I (47) boot.esp32: SPI Flash Size : 4MB
- I (52) boot: Enabling RNG early entropy source...
- I (57) boot: Partition Table:
- I (60) boot: ## Label Usage Type ST Offset Length
- I (68) boot: 0 nvs WiFi data 01 02 00009000 00004000
- I (75) boot: 1 otadata OTA data 01 00 0000d000 00002000
- I (83) boot: 2 phy_init RF data 01 01 0000f000 00001000
- I (90) boot: 3 factory factory app 00 00 00010000 00200000
- I (98) boot: End of partition table
- I (102) boot: Defaulting to factory image
- I (107) boot_comm: chip revision: 1, min. application chip revision: 0
- I (114) esp_image: segment 0: paddr=00010020 vaddr=3f400020 size=2a8a4h (174244) map
- I (188) esp_image: segment 1: paddr=0003a8cc vaddr=3ffbdb60 size=04eb4h ( 20148) load
- I (196) esp_image: segment 2: paddr=0003f788 vaddr=40080000 size=00890h ( 2192) load
- I (198) esp_image: segment 3: paddr=00040020 vaddr=400d0020 size=a4c3ch (674876) map
- I (457) esp_image: segment 4: paddr=000e4c64 vaddr=40080890 size=163d4h ( 91092) load
- I (496) esp_image: segment 5: paddr=000fb040 vaddr=50000000 size=00010h ( 16) load
- I (509) boot: Loaded app from partition at offset 0x10000
- I (509) boot: Disabling RNG early entropy source...
- I (521) cpu_start: Pro cpu up.
- I (521) cpu_start: Starting app cpu, entry point is 0x400812bc
- 0x400812bc: call_start_cpu1 at C:/ESP32/esp-idf/components/esp_system/port/cpu_start.c:141
- I (0) cpu_start: App cpu up.
- I (537) cpu_start: Pro cpu start user code
- I (537) cpu_start: cpu freq: 160000000
- I (537) cpu_start: Application information:
- I (542) cpu_start: Project name: fast_prov_server
- I (547) cpu_start: App version: 1
- I (552) cpu_start: Compile time: Aug 29 2021 12:40:20
- I (558) cpu_start: ELF file SHA256: 35414a86278e2ab4...
- I (564) cpu_start: ESP-IDF: v4.3
- I (569) heap_init: Initializing. RAM available for dynamic allocation:
- I (576) heap_init: At 3FFAFF10 len 000000F0 (0 KiB): DRAM
- I (582) heap_init: At 3FFB6388 len 00001C78 (7 KiB): DRAM
- I (588) heap_init: At 3FFB9A20 len 00004108 (16 KiB): DRAM
- I (594) heap_init: At 3FFCCC90 len 00013370 (76 KiB): DRAM
- I (600) heap_init: At 3FFE0440 len 00003AE0 (14 KiB): D/IRAM
- I (606) heap_init: At 3FFE4350 len 0001BCB0 (111 KiB): D/IRAM
- I (613) heap_init: At 40096C64 len 0000939C (36 KiB): IRAM
- I (620) spi_flash: detected chip: generic
- I (624) spi_flash: flash io: dio
- I (629) cpu_start: Starting scheduler on PRO CPU.
- I (0) cpu_start: Starting scheduler on APP CPU.
- I (639) EXAMPLE: Initializing...
- I (639) gpio: GPIO[17]| InputEn: 0| OutputEn: 0| OpenDrain: 0| Pullup: 1| Pulldown: 0| Intr:0
- I (649) gpio: GPIO[18]| InputEn: 0| OutputEn: 0| OpenDrain: 0| Pullup: 1| Pulldown: 0| Intr:0
- I (659) gpio: GPIO[19]| InputEn: 0| OutputEn: 0| OpenDrain: 0| Pullup: 1| Pulldown: 0| Intr:0
- I (689) BTDM_INIT: BT controller compile version [1342a48]
- I (689) system_api: Base MAC address is not set
- I (689) system_api: read default base MAC address from EFUSE
- I (699) phy_init: phy_version 4670,719f9f6,Feb 18 2021,17:07:07
- I (2809) EXAMPLE: ESP_BLE_MESH_PROV_REGISTER_COMP_EVT, err_code: 0
- I (2809) EXAMPLE: BLE Mesh Fast Prov Node initialized
- I (2819) EXAMPLE: ESP_BLE_MESH_NODE_PROV_ENABLE_COMP_EVT, err_code: 0
- I (19739) EXAMPLE: ESP_BLE_MESH_NODE_PROV_LINK_OPEN_EVT, bearer: PB-GATT
- I (20209) EXAMPLE: ESP_BLE_MESH_NODE_PROV_LINK_CLOSE_EVT, bearer: PB-GATT
- I (20209) EXAMPLE: ESP_BLE_MESH_NODE_PROV_COMPLETE_EVT
- I (20209) EXAMPLE: net_idx: 0x0001, unicast_addr: 0x0002
- I (20219) EXAMPLE: flags: 0x00, iv_index: 0x00000000
- I (20839) EXAMPLE: example_ble_mesh_config_server_cb, event = 0x00, opcode = 0x0000, addr: 0x0001
- I (20839) EXAMPLE: Config Server get Config AppKey Add
- I (21069) EXAMPLE: example_ble_mesh_custom_model_cb: Fast prov server receives msg, opcode 0xc002e5
- I (21069) fast prov server recv: c3 03 64 00 00 04 00 c0 01 00 dd dd 81
- I (21079) EXAMPLE: ESP_BLE_MESH_SET_FAST_PROV_INFO_COMP_EVT
- I (21089) EXAMPLE: status_unicast: 0x00, status_net_idx: 0x00, status_match 0x00
- I (21089) EXAMPLE: ESP_BLE_MESH_SET_FAST_PROV_ACTION_COMP_EVT, status_action 0x00
- I (21109) EXAMPLE: ESP_BLE_MESH_MODEL_SEND_COMP_EVT, err_code 0
- I (21109) FAST_PROV_SERVER: example_handle_fast_prov_status_send_comp_evt: opcode 0xc102e5
- W (21119) FAST_PROV_SERVER: example_handle_fast_prov_status_send_comp_evt: Disable BLE Mesh Relay & GATT Proxy
- W (21129) BT_APPL: gattc_conn_cb: if=4 st=0 id=4 rsn=0x16
- I (21149) EXAMPLE: ESP_BLE_MESH_NODE_PROXY_GATT_DISABLE_COMP_EVT
I have a problem with this idf example (ble_mesh_fast_provision)
I run this code without any change build successfully and program devkit is ok but mesh network doesn't work
it just connect to one node, not more
and I do all steps in sample ble_mesh_fast_provision youtube video
****
I run again and again this example :
(ble_mesh_fast_provision)
https://github.com/espressif/esp-idf/tr ... erver/main
when I scan for unprovision node I find theme, after that I select a node and select fast provisioning
when app start scan to find this just found one node and I dont know why ?
I use fast_prov_server program for all of my nodes
every thing is look ok but nodes doesn't join to the mesh network, a warning happen Disable BLE Mesh Relay & GATT Proxy
and stay forever in a scanning loop
Come On Guys I need Your Help
this is my terminal result: